Known in Italian as sughero, cork is extremely important to Sardinia. So it's only natural that the lightweight material found its way into the hands of artisans. Cork oak lumberjacks take their axes to the tree's outer layer, stripping away only thick rectangles of bark. One rarely thinks of trees when they think of islands. It is the only Italian region where cork grows naturally and it produces 80 percent of the corks used in Italy. When we talk about mirto, we don't think of the luxuriant scrub that invades every corner of the island, but of the liqueur that is the symbol of, the intoxicating scent of Sardinia.
Like amaro liqueurs, those bittersweet after-dinner tipples that are common on the mainland, mirto is the perfect way to close out a large lunch.
